Transaction 66ca9d2d702c2651654cdbaf5818c20b93ee2a63737772cd10b7e95f66555ef4
1 Input
1 Output
-
66ca9d2d702c2651654cdbaf5818c20b93ee2a63737772cd10b7e95f66555ef4:0
- value
- 107763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b81bd169b6bb02ea8bd012d621c458be15ec3fa9 OP_EQUAL
- address
- 3JUVafqYD9JLrM99iQGJNohWmyk26xxsEk